A review by cynthiajasper
The Blackhouse by Peter May
4.0
I started reading this book on Lewis and Harris, so my point of view might be altered indefinitely by the expansive, lonely bogs of Lewis and the breathtaking beaches and mountains of Harris. The sense of place was strong with this book, and I developed an understanding of the importance of traditions - such as the guga hunts of Ness. The mystery was slow paced, but believable. I would definitely consider reading the second book.
